It's a nice sunny afternoon; kids are playing in the street when all of a
sudden two opposing gangs cross each others paths. The quiet sunny afternoon
quickly turns into a gang brawl, with golf clubs and various weapons being swung
around whilst young men punch each other senseless. This didn't happen out of
sight - it went on in full public view as crowds of local kids watched the proceedings.
The two opposing groups, after attempting to knock each other out, retreated to there
cars and then the usual name calling and threats were shouted back and forth. A few
minutes later they were back for round two, in a different spot this time, and it
was reported that at least one of the participants was likely hospitalised.
Below - a photograph of one of the weapons that was used - a golf club
can be a weapon of choice as it is not in itself illegal. When it's
being swung at someone's head though, it becomes an offensive weapon
and a very dangerous one. The golf club was broken in the brawl.
Can we get a witness?
The Police on the beat in Kirkby know that the odds of people appearing
as witnesses are slim. Fights like the one witnessed above, are often not
reported or are done so anonymously. No-one will intervene, gone are the
days when local mums and dads could keep order in the streets - not that
gang fights are anything new round here - but the viciousness is more
apparent and more likely to take place in residential areas, despite
the massive number of CCTV's being placed here.
Incidents like this are fairly common in Kirkby, the use of weapons
has sadly become more common and the old fashioned 'straighteners'
which would take place away from the publics gaze, are almost going
out of fashion. Grudges or simple 'bad vibes' between individuals
become mass grudges between gangs and the matter can flare up whenever
members of the gangs are in the same pub or even pass each other in cars.
The gang culture has always been big in Merseyside and other working class
areas; the sheer destruction of our communities by the politicians has
created prime conditions for gangs to flourish. This fight was one of
3 separate incidents all taking place around the same streets within
the space of a few hours. The previous week saw another attack in the
same area in broad day-light; an ambulance was called out to carry the
victim away.
